Duties Description
Reporting to the Executive Deputy Secretary of State, the Deputy Secretary of State for Economic Opportunity provides executive and operational oversight and policy guidance for major program areas of the Department of State that include the Office for New Americans, the Division of Community Services, the Division of Consumer Protection, and the Address Confidentiality Program. Minimum Qualifications Minimum Qualifications
Bachelor's degree and eight years of relevant and progressively responsible professional experience in programs providing services to vulnerable populations, or those with targeted service needs. At least three of the required years of experience must have been in a managerial capacity that included both program direction and managing staff.
Four years of specialized experience; or an Associate's degree and two years of specialized experience may substitute for required Bachelor's degree.
J.D. or Master's degree may substitute for one year of specialized experience; Ph.D. may substitute for two years of specialized experience.
